Environmental health and safety is an interdisciplinary field, incorporating aspects of business, health sciences, and education.  For many topics you may need to search multiple databases in these areas to find relevant information.

Use Library OneSearch - the OU Libraries' consolidated catalog - to find print and electronic books, book chapters, journals, articles, news items, and more!

Try a search like workplace safety program*, then use the "Source Type" filter option to limit your results to the specific type of item (e.g. book, article, etc.) you need.
